Yes, it is an RCA that really works and works Great!, November 16, 2007
This review is from: RCA DRC8030N DVD Recorder with 80GB Hard Drive (Electronics)
When I purchased this DVD recorder about a year and a half ago, I was very skeptical about how well it would perform. I have had problems with previous RCA products, however, the price on this unit was just too good to be true. Boy have I been glad I purchased it. This recorder has far exceeded my expectations. It has almost no delay when you hit the record button. It accepts many different DVD disk formats. Hard drive recording and program transfers from the hard drive to a DVD disk have been flawless. It takes a while to learn to use the unit. It is a little complicated but the effort will be worth it. The Remote is well designed and works very well. There are several record quality settings which can allow a lot recording on a DVD disk with just a little loss in picture quality in the higher compression modes. At any rate, I would highly recommend this recorder to anyone if you can find it. Mine has been a real winner. It is still performing flawless and I have recorded hundreds of hours of programs with it. If this recorder were to quit today, I would say that I got more than my money's worth from it and I would definately buy another one just like it.

A pretty good little DVD Recorder, September 1, 2008
This review is from: RCA DRC8030N DVD Recorder with 80GB Hard Drive (Electronics)
I've had this unit about a year and a half and it has filled my simple needs quite well - recording films not now or ever likely to be on DVD to the hard disk via timers - since the films I want to see often come on in the dead of night or while I'm at work - and copying those films to DVD if I decide they are good enough to keep. You can even edit out commercials if necessary via the "Hide Chapter" option. I have noted a few problems, but these may be present on other DVRs:
1. Anything running longer than about 80 minutes or so records in "real time".
2. If you are around the border of that time - 80 minutes - the recorder will get confused and chop the film off before it is finished recording. Solution: leave some buffer at the end if you are around that limit.
3. DVD-Rs often have artifacts in them. I did not have this problem when I graduated to DVD+Rs as recording media.
4. One day I decided to record a big block of films in one 10 hour block. When I came home, the DVR had arbitrarily divided the recordings into two blocks, one that lasted about six hours and one about four. When I tried "chopping up" the six hour block of films into individual movies for recording purposes, the DVR got "lost" and the entire six hour block of movies was lost to me.
On the plus side, it is easy to use, gives great video/audio quality, and most importantly apparently is lacking that "feature" that many newer DVRs have of refusing to copy modern movies or any movie that plays on "either side" of one time-wise. If I've copied a movie made in 1930 that aired just after a modern film, this can cause problems.
